## v4.2.0 — Changed defaults

Stagecharm's seat-map renderer for the Velvetine Theatre now defaults to vector tiles instead of rasterized sprites. Zoom caching is enabled out of the box, and the orphan-seat warning threshold dropped from 12 to 4. If render latency alerts fire tonight, check the tile cache hit rate before rolling back; the sprite path is still available behind a flag. The full set of defaults the renderer now ships with is listed below.

service settings:
HOLIX_HOST=holix.qorvelsys.internal
HOLIX_PORT=7000

### v2.8.3 — Fixed intermittent DNS resolution failures

Plugin authors relying on the Marrowtide gateway's outbound resolver no longer need retry shims: we replaced the per-request resolver with a cached pool and added negative-cache expiry of 30 seconds. Plugins overriding resolver settings should remove custom timeouts. Questions about resolver behavior go to the maintainer named below.

named custodian: Brivan Eliath Quenox Frador

Manager-Only Wiki: Sale of the Fernhollow Logistics Unit

Heads up, branch managers — Calveron Holdings has agreed in principle to sell the Fernhollow unit to Ostrev Partners. Day-to-day operations don't change yet: routes, staffing, and depots stay as-is until closing. Don't speculate with staff; an official announcement pack is coming. Questions should go up through regional leads, not sideways. Transition timelines will be posted here once signatures land. The confidential note on what comes next is directly below.

internal memo for hafog-hadug: The pricing group signed off on a budget of $16.1 million for Project Gorir. The renewal with Oliionax Systems closes at $14.1 million a year, 46 percent above the last contract.

## Idempotency Keys for Payment Retries (Lumopay)

Every retry of a charge request must reuse the original idempotency key; generating a new key on retry can produce duplicate charges. Keys are scoped per merchant and expire after 48 hours. Reviewers should verify keys are derived server-side, never from client input. The full key-generation specification and threat model are maintained on the internal page.

dashboard of kaguf-tawip = https://vault.merlaqsys.test/issue